Kinds Of Car Keys
The car secrets can be classified into numerous types, each requiring unique locksmith services. Below is an extensive table highlighting the primary types of car secrets and their qualities:
| Type of Car Key | Description | Key Features |
|---|---|---|
| Traditional Keys | These are basic metal secrets, cut to fit locks. | Basic design, low cost, no electronic elements. |
| Transponder Keys | Embedded chips that interact with the car's engine. | Boosted security, requires programs. |
| Smart Keys | Keyless entry systems; typically manage several functions. | Remote start, panic button, requires specialized tools. |
| Key Fobs | Push-button controls for locking/unlocking the vehicle. | Push-button ignition, improved security functions. |
| Switchblade Keys | A secret that folds into the fob for portability. | Integrates traditional and fob features, compact style. |
Standard Keys
Standard secrets are perhaps the most basic and most common kind of car secrets. They are cut from a strong piece of metal and operate on a basic locking mechanism. These secrets can regularly be replicated without needing any special equipment.
Transponder Keys
Transponder keys have ended up being the standard for the majority of contemporary lorries due to their added security features. Each transponder secret consists of a tiny chip configured to the car's ECU (Engine Control Unit). If the secret is not acknowledged, the automobile will not begin, making it tough for burglars to duplicate.
Smart Keys and Key Fobs
Smart keys and essential fobs represent the latest development in automobile locking technology. These systems permit motorists to open doors, start the engine, and control other functions from a distance. However, they also include a higher price when replacement is necessary and need specialized shows to guarantee compatibility with the lorry.
Switchblade Keys
Switchblade keys are a hybrid between standard and modern styles. These keys fold into a fob, making them compact and easy to bring. They likewise frequently house a transponder chip, including a layer of security that drivers appreciate.
Common Issues with Car Keys
Much like any mechanical or electronic device, car keys can encounter various concerns. Understanding these typical issues can help automobile owners determine and resolve concerns faster.
1. Lost or Stolen Keys
Losing a car secret is among the most typical issues faced by car owners. In the case of a lost key, a locksmith can assist either create a new secret or rekey the locks entirely.
2. Broken Keys
Car keys can break off inside locks or ignition systems. An expert locksmith has the tools and competence to extract broken secrets without damaging the lock.
3. Malfunctioning Fobs
Secret fobs can experience battery concerns or programming mistakes, making them unresponsive. A locksmith can frequently troubleshoot these problems and reprogram the fob when needed.
4. Ignition Problems
In some cases the issue lies not with the key however with the ignition system itself. If an essential won't kip down the ignition, it may suggest a problem that needs a locksmith's attention.
5. Duplicate Keys
While replicating standard secrets is straightforward, creating duplicates for transponder secrets or clever secrets requires specialized devices and knowledge.

Expense Comparisons for Common Locksmith Services
The cost of locksmith services can vary extensively based upon the service provided and the intricacy of the task. Below is a table offering an approximated rates variety for typical locksmith services associated with car keys:
| Service | Approximated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Key Duplication | ₤ 2 - ₤ 5 (Traditional) |
| Transponder Key Programming |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
| Smart Key Replacement | ₤ 200 - ₤ 500 |
| Ignition Repair | ₤ 100 - ₤ 200 |
| Emergency Lockout Service |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
Frequently Asked Questions about Locksmith Car Keys
Q1: Can all locksmith professionals make car secrets?
A1: Not all locksmiths have the devices or expertise to develop car secrets, especially modern transponder or smart keys. Always validate their expertise in vehicle locksmithing.
Q2: How long does it take to make a new car key?
A2: The time varies by type of secret. Conventional keys can be made in minutes, while setting a transponder or smart secret can take 30 minutes to an hour.
Q3: Are there any threats in utilizing a locksmith?
A3: To decrease threats, always pick certified and insured locksmith professionals. Ensure they have good evaluations to validate their dependability and professionalism.
Q4: What should I do if my key breaks off in the lock?
A4: Avoid attempting to extract it yourself, as this can damage the lock. Contact an expert locksmith for safe elimination.
Q5: Can I configure my own transponder key?
A5: Some vehicles allow owners to configure their own transponder secrets using particular treatments described in the owner's handbook. However, many need professional programming.
